Delighted Bottas hails 'best weekend ever'

– Williams driver Valtteri Bottas hailed the Austrian Grand Prix as his "best weekend" in Formula 1 after taking a maiden podium finish.Although the Finn, who started the race from second on the grid, lost out to Mercedes drivers Nico Rosberg and Lewis Hamilton in the pit-stop phases, he was able to get the jump on team-mate Felipe Massa.The result marked Williams' first podium since the 2012 Spanish Grand Prix, when now Lotus driver Pastor Maldonado took the victory."I think it was my best ever weekend," Bottas told reporters after the race."I'm really happy for us as a team.
